GauGAN2
GauGAN2 Features
  • Allows users to create photorealistic landscape images from simple sketches
  • Uses generative adversarial networks (GANs) to synthesize images
  • Has an intuitive painting interface for creating sketches
  • Provides control over high-level aspects like seasons and time of day
  • Outputs high-resolution images

GauGAN2
GauGAN2
Pros
  • Easy to use even for non-artists
  • Creates realistic images from simple inputs
  • Allows creative flexibility through sketching
  • Great way to visualize landscape designs
  • Saves time compared to manual landscape painting
Cons
  • Limited to landscape images for now
  • Requires high-end GPU for best performance
  • Some artifacts may occur in synthesized images
  • Not as customizable as manual painting
  • Model requires training on large datasets
